| Summary: | Fanconi- Bickel Syndrome (FBS) is a rare glycogen storage disease (GSD) . Transient diabetes is rarely reported with FBS. We describe a patient with FBS diagnosed by diabetes findings and identification of a mutation in the GLUT2. A male infant, from a consanguineous marriage, presented with hyperglycemia and urinary system infections at 59 days and was given insulin therapy. At age 3 months, insulin was discontinued. Neonatal diabetes may be a first presentation of infants with FBS. [Med-Science 2017; 6(1.000): 111-3] |
